How they compare
Belarus currently reports 7.71 units per square kilometre against 7.04 units per square kilometre in Faroe Islands, a difference of 0.67 units per square kilometre.
That makes Belarus's figure about 1.1 times Faroe Islands's.
Across all 32 years both countries report, Belarus has been ahead every year.
Belarus ranks 107th and Faroe Islands ranks 110th of 215 countries.
Belarus has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
Population ages 65 and above, total div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
